Stuffed Manicotti

1 pound of bulk pork sausage
two 15 ounce cans of tomato sauce
one 16 ounce can of tomato paste
1/4 cup of water
1/2 tablespoon of packed light brown sugar
Grated Parmesan cheese
one 15 ounce carton Ricotta cheese
3 cups of shredded Mozzarella cheese
1 egg
1 teaspoon of parsley flakes
12 manicotti noodles, cooked, rinsed and drained
 

In large saucepan, brown sausage, drain. Remove half of sausage; set aside. Stir tomato sauce, paste, water and brown sugar into sausage; simmer 15 minutes. Meanwhile, in medium bowl, combine remaining sausage, Ricotta, 2 cups Mozzarella, egg and parsley. In 13x9x2 inch baking dish, pour 1/3 spaghetti sauce mixture. Stuff manicotti noodles with Ricotta mixture and place on top of sauce. Pour remaining sauce over filled noodles, top with remaining Mozzarella and sprinkle with Parmesan. Bake, uncovered, at 350ºF. for 20 minutes. Makes 6 to 8 servings.
